### Order Cutoff — Crumbline API

The Crumbline order service enforces a daily cutoff for next-morning bakery orders: requests received after the configured cutoff (default 16:00 shop-local time) are queued for the following production day. The `cutoff/override` endpoint lets on-call temporarily extend the window during incidents; overrides expire automatically at midnight. All override calls must be authenticated against the internal ops service using the key below.

app token of badug-tahaf = qvz11-nP5FBNr8qnh

**Quarterly Planning Note — Tessmark Logistics**

Heads of department: effective next quarter, hiring in the Coastal Freight division is frozen. Volumes there have flattened and Joren Hale wants headcount held until the Marbeck corridor review concludes. Backfills require his sign-off; other divisions are unaffected. Contractors already engaged may complete their terms. Please plan workloads accordingly. The confidential note below covers the wider business context.

confidential, kagup-bafog: Fraaxax Group is in early talks to buy Soroxox Group for about $343.8 million. The Olidor launch date is June 14, and nothing goes to the press before then. Legal wants the Aldmirek Logistics term sheet signed before July 23.

## Cron Drift Notes

Summary for release managers: the Tidemark cron fleet drifted up to 40s after the Harrowgate NTP migration. Releases must not cut over until drift is under 2s. Re-sync via the Clockhaven admin shell, which unlocks with the recovery passphrase below.

recovery phrase for fawif-tajeg: norael-aldmir-casir-brivan-ulaion